Output 2c668ceb63877b39f20ab417aee752117d32ef26dc8ba0460b96cef9755adfa3:0
- value
- 40135782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07394c12d30330c552408e8cb2453f65c7b419c3 OP_EQUAL
- address
- 32MDHxpRwcfZ1KrbxE3aMsw3jpXGYLNjsZ
- transaction
- 2c668ceb63877b39f20ab417aee752117d32ef26dc8ba0460b96cef9755adfa3
- confirmations
- 344716
- spent
- true